The majority of employees at T-Mobile believe the environment at T-Mobile is positive. Most Participants believe the pace of work at T-Mobile is comfortably fast. About 62% of the employees at T-Mobile work 8 hours or less, while 5% of them have an extremely long day – longer than twelve hours.

What benefits do T-Mobile employees get?

  • Medical. Dental. Vision. Flexible Spending Accounts. …
  • T-Mobile 401(k) Savings Plan. Employee Stock Grant. Employee Stock Purchase Plan. (ESPP)
  • Paid Time Off (PTO) Holidays. Paid Parental Leave. Adoption and Surrogacy Assistance. …
  • Employee Mobile Service Discount. Voluntary Benefits. Employee Discounts + Perks.

Does T-Mobile give raises? T-Mobile is dialing up a pay raise. The company said its hourly workers will make a minimum wage of $20 an hour. The change applies to every employee, regardless of their role or whether they’re full-time or part-time.

Does T-Mobile give bonuses?

Monthly Bonuses – Bring home an average total of $1,000 in bonus pay each year when you meet or exceed your goals. When you move to Expert, your bonus opportunity increases to up to $4,000 each year. Stock Grant – $1,000 worth of T-Mobile stock granted each year because everyone is an owner!

Why is T-Mobile so successful? T-Mobile is a Trailblazer in the customer-obsessed revolution. To that end, T-Mobile has thrown out service contracts, roaming fees, and data limits. Since 2016, the Un-carrier has offered unlimited 4G LTE data for every plan.

Does T-Mobile make money?

Overall, Postpaid Plans & Phones revenue increased from $24.1 billion in 2016 to $27.7 billion in 2018, driven by higher revenues from postpaid mobile plans and equipment. We expect revenue to grow by 11% in the next two years, to about $30.7 billion in 2020, driven by growth in postpaid revenues.

How many employees does T-Mobile have?

T-Mobile US, Inc. is an American telecommunications company headquartered in Bellevue, Washington. The company has approximately 75,000 employees and generated revenues of around 68 billion U.S. dollars, placing it only behind AT&T, and Verizon in the U.S. telecommunications market.
